Opportunity:
RN - PACU
Job Details:
* Minimum 3 years of PACU experience required
* Ambulatory Surgery Center experience required
* Charge Nurse experience required
* Active California RN license required at time of submission
* Required certifications: BLS and ACLS
* No weekend shifts required
* No floating required
* No on-call required
* Support ambulatory surgery center startup and operational setup
* Assist with AAAHC survey preparation and accreditation readiness
* Assist with regulatory compliance and policy/procedure development
* Assist the DON with quality program development and quality binders
* Apply strong administrative and project management skills
* Work independently and drive projects to completion
* Edit forms, documents, and policies
* Proficiency with Microsoft Office applications required
* Knowledge of infection control and minor life safety required
* Clinical cases include approximately 10 trigger finger procedures, pain management, or minor orthopedic procedures performed under local anesthesia
* Expected to work with GE patient monitor, glucometer, bladder scanner, and 12-lead EKG equipment
* Patient population: adults
* Patient ratio: 1:1 during day shifts
* 16 orientation hours provided
Facility:
This ambulatory surgery center is in the startup and operational setup phase, offering a unique opportunity to play an integral role in building and shaping a new healthcare facility. The center will focus on orthopedic procedures, total joint procedures, pain management, and spine procedures, supported by interdisciplinary services including interpretation services, radiology, and pharmacy. The facility maintains a patient-centered approach with modern medical equipment and a focus on regulatory compliance and quality care standards.
